The market for smart headphones is seeing dynamic movements that are fueled by both shifting customer tastes and technology advancements. The growing popularity of true wireless earbuds is one important trend influencing the industry. Cord-free audio solutions are becoming more and more popular as customers seek convenience and mobility. True wireless and wireless headphones provide users the flexibility to roam around without being connected to a device, which makes them well-liked options for daily multitasking, working out, and commuting. This tendency is consistent with the wider movement towards a wireless environment, where consumers appreciate the ease of use and adaptability provided by smart headphones with Bluetooth.
In the market for smart headphones, integrating cutting-edge functions like noise cancellation is also a popular trend. With the use of cutting-edge technology, noise-canceling headphones can block out or minimize outside noise, giving consumers a focused and uninterrupted listening experience. The need to establish a personal acoustic environment in loud surroundings and the growing demand for improved audio quality are the driving forces behind this trend. Noise-canceling capabilities are becoming a sought-after feature in the smart headphones market, appealing to individuals who favor audio clarity and focus—whether it's in a busy office or on a packed commute.
The trend of smart assistants and headphones coming together is also something to notice. These days, a lot of smart headphones include built-in voice-activated virtual assistants, such as Apple's Siri, Google Assistant, or Amazon Alexa. With this connection, customers may use voice commands to operate tasks, obtain information, and manage their headphones. This pattern reflects the increasing use of virtual assistants across a range of devices, resulting in a smooth and hands-free user experience. Customers like how convenient it is to use their voice commands to control playback, send messages, and check the weather while sporting their smart headphones.
In the market for smart headphones, personalization and customization functions are also becoming more popular. Through companion applications that let users adjust equalization settings, sound profiles, and even bespoke hearing profiles, manufacturers are enabling customers to tailor their audio experience. Users may customize their audio experience according to activities, specific hearing sensitivity, or musical genres thanks to this trend, which accommodates a wide range of user preferences. Customized audio modification increases user happiness and benefits the overall market growth.
